Research Abstract |
CST (Cdc13-Stn1-Ten1) complex of the budding yeast Saccharomyces cerevisiae has been shown to associate with the telomeric DNA ends and to be involved in telomere replication and protection. Stn1 was phosphorylated by Cdk during specific times during the cell cycle, and the phosphorylation regulated telomere elongation negatively. In addition, we found that an stn1 mutant defective in its protective function resulted in telomere elongation via the recombination- and telomerase-dependent mechanisms. Moreover, we found that telomere shortening-mediated cellular senescence induced autophagy by regulating the TOR-signaling pathway and the telomere-binding protein Rap1.
